Chapter 32
Huo Xingming couldn’t understand why Bai Siyi was so resistant to him.
After getting home, he couldn’t help but stand in front of the full-length mirror in his bathroom while showering, turning left and right to examine himself. No matter how he looked, he thought he looked pretty decent!
Touching his chin, Huo Xingming muttered, “Could it be that my muscles aren’t defined enough?”
Lately, because of conflicts with his family, he had left home and hadn’t been able to afford a gym membership.
His little house had only two floors—it wasn’t big. His mother had given it to him when he was young, and since he had spent most of his time abroad, he rarely came back. So naturally, there was no home gym.
Other than his daily morning runs, he hadn’t been working out at all!
Huo Xingming reached out and touched his abs, then his chest muscles, and finally squeezed his biceps.
“Tsk, I really need to start training again.”
Running a hand through his hair narcissistically, he thought, “Good thing my face still looks good.”
But soon, his excitement deflated again.
He was tall with long legs, had an eight-pack, and a decent face—so why didn’t Bai Siyi like him?
If it was because of his debts, well, pre-marital debt is a personal responsibility. He had already told Bai Siyi that he didn’t need to worry about it.
But Bai Siyi had still shaken his head. Why?
Feeling frustrated, Huo Xingming wondered: Could it simply be that Bai Siyi doesn’t like mixed-race people?
Maybe he only liked purely East Asian features?
That was actually a real possibility. Huo Xingming had heard from classmates before that some people just didn’t like mixed-race individuals, or didn’t find white or Black people attractive. It wasn’t racism—it was just personal preference.
So, he looked into the mirror again, scrutinizing his eyes and hair. His natural hair was black with a slight brown tint, and his eyes were an amber color. He had already dyed his hair black—should he try wearing colored contacts too?
Feeling down, he wrapped a towel around himself, walked out of the bathroom, and couldn’t resist calling Jiang Fengjing. “Aren’t you one of the show’s investors? Send me Bai Siyi’s profile card, will you?”
Jiang Fengjing: “……”
Jiang Fengjing was speechless. “Bro, I’m just a minor investor. Do you really think I’m the only one funding this show? Do you think I’m the sugar daddy of the whole production team?”
Huo Xingming got annoyed. “You’re an investor, so what’s the big deal about giving me a contestant’s profile? You just don’t want to help me! You’re such a bad friend!”
Jiang Fengjing: “……”
“Please don’t insult me like that, I’m scared.”
Irritated, Huo Xingming paced around his room. He had a short temper, and with his phone on speaker, he went to the fridge to grab a drink.
Jiang Fengjing asked in a patient tone, “What happened now? What’s going on between you two again?”
Feeling wronged, Huo Xingming muttered, “I asked Bai Siyi what he planned to do for the confession segment, and he said he’s going to write me a thank-you letter.”
Huo Xingming pouted, and suddenly, the juice in his mouth didn’t taste sweet anymore.
Jiang Fengjing: “……”
Jiang Fengjing: “If he’s writing you a thank-you letter, that means he’s passing on you. Isn’t it normal for people not to be into each other in a dating show?”
Huo Xingming: “But I don’t want to pass on him. And if I don’t pass on him but he rejects me, he’ll stay on the show, and then the production team will pair him up with another male contestant.”
Just thinking about it made Huo Xingming furious.
What kind of lousy production team was this? What kind of ridiculous rules?
In order to prevent Bai Siyi from being matched with another guy, his only option was to write him a thank-you letter.
A thank-you letter meant rejecting him. But he clearly liked Bai Siyi!
Jiang Fengjing thought this situation sounded complicated—almost like there was no way out. But after thinking about it carefully, it actually seemed quite simple.
Jiang Fengjing offered a suggestion: “Since he already said that, just write a thank-you letter.”
Huo Xingming’s face darkened. “No way!”
He liked Bai Siyi. He wanted to write him a love letter!
Jiang Fengjing clicked his tongue. “Just hear me out first.”
Jiang Fengjing explained, “If you both write thank-you letters, it means you both pass on each other. Then, you two will exit the show, and another pair of contestants will take your place. That way, you also get some time to cool off.”
Speaking in a serious tone, Jiang Fengjing reasoned, “Think about it—you were gay before, right? You’ve said you knew from a young age that you liked men. So why would something you’ve been sure about for over a decade suddenly change just because of one online dating show?”
At this, Huo Xingming hesitated.
He had known since childhood that he liked men—there was no doubt about it.
He had never questioned himself. Even his family knew about his orientation, and no one had ever given him a hard time about it. It had always felt perfectly normal to him.
So how did things suddenly change just because of one dating show? Just because he met Bai Siyi, his firm grasp on his sexuality was now shaky?
Huo Xingming’s voice turned somber. “I couldn’t understand it before either. But later, I figured it out—I just like Bai Siyi as a person. I like who she is. I like her quiet nature, the little world she keeps to herself. I think liking someone is just liking someone. It’s not complicated. It has nothing to do with her identity, and nothing to do with her gender.”
Jiang Fengjing, a seasoned playboy with countless flings, was actually left speechless by Huo Xingming’s heartfelt confession.
For a moment, he almost couldn’t resist telling Huo Xingming the truth about Bai Siyi.
But what little professional ethics he had left held him back.
Jiang Fengjing sighed. “That’s exactly why I’m saying—you two should leave the show together and go back to the real world. That way, you won’t be forced to go on dates with Bai Siyi every day, won’t have to stick to her all the time. If you separate for a few days and cool off, maybe you’ll realize that what you feel for Bai Siyi isn’t love—it’s just curiosity playing tricks on you.”
This time, Huo Xingming stayed silent for a long while.
Jiang Fengjing thought he had finally convinced him. “See? Makes sense, doesn’t it?”
After a moment, Huo Xingming asked gloomily, “What does ‘playing tricks on you’ mean?”
Jiang Fengjing: “……”
Jiang Fengjing didn’t manage to convince Huo Xingming, but Huo Xingming did come up with an idea.
Leaving the show was actually a good choice.
Once he and Bai Siyi were out of the show, they could go to and from work together every day. Without the constraints of live cameras, they could do a lot more and talk about a lot more.
Huo Xingming felt he had a pretty good chance. Not for any other reason—just because he was extremely confident in his looks.
Seeing the time, Huo Xingming immediately hung up the phone. “No more talking, I need to work out.”
Jiang Fengjing: “……”
Wearing a tank top and shorts, Huo Xingming started doing push-ups and sit-ups in his bedroom. He planned to buy workout equipment the next day and convert the study on the first floor into a home gym.
Fitness couldn’t be neglected for even a single day—otherwise, his wife would run away.
Despite all his hard work—exercising diligently every day and following Bai Siyi to work without ever complaining—Bai Siyi still barely paid him any attention.
The worst part?
For some reason, Bai Siyi had stopped eating with him altogether in the past two days!
The factory provided three free meals a day—breakfast, lunch, and dinner!
And yet, Bai Siyi hadn’t joined him for a single meal!

The production team backstage felt a bit regretful seeing this.
To be honest, nobody had high expectations for Huo Xingming and Bai Siyi as a couple at first. Director Liu had only arranged for Bai Siyi in women’s clothing and a male contestant in men’s clothing to create a bit of contrast and generate some buzz.
Who would’ve thought this CP would blow up?
Especially after Huo Xingming made his official debut and got his own live streaming room. The moment the audience realized that Huo Xingming was only pretending to be poor—and was also gay—the internet went wild.
【Xiao Bai likes men. Piupiustar also likes men. But neither of them knows about the other. And they’re both feeling guilty and conflicted over it. This is peak drama!】
【When will they finally confess to each other and realize they’re both into men? When will Piupiustar finally open his eyes and realize that Xiao Bai is a guy?!】
【Guys! Let’s all chip in ten bucks to get Piupiustar a new pair of eyes! His current ones are useless!】
—
Seeing the audience’s comments, Director Liu grinned and said, “But there’s no need to worry too much. Once the confession segment comes around, Huo Xingming will find out that Bai Siyi is a man.”
After all, it was written in the contract—if Huo Xingming still didn’t know Bai Siyi’s gender by the time they reached the confession stage, Bai Siyi would be required to explain it to him.
Otherwise, where would the drama be?
This kind of messy plot was exactly what made the show interesting.
At this moment, Huo Xingming had no idea that not only did he and Bai Siyi have CP fans now, but they even had an official CP name—“Bai Xing Yiyi.” If he knew, he’d probably be over the moon.
But right now, Huo Xingming was troubled by the fact that, despite working in the same factory, Bai Siyi refused to eat with him!
Huo Xingming worked hard every day and always finished on time for meals. Since Bai Siyi never came to find him, he assumed Bai Siyi was just caught up with work. So, he took the initiative to go to Bai Siyi’s workshop to look for him—only to find that every time, Bai Siyi had either already gone to eat or had finished eating and left early.
After all, during the show’s recording, Bai Siyi didn’t have much work to do. But Huo Xingming, as a new employee still in his probation period, had a supervisor who showed no mercy when assigning tasks.
After washing his hands and face, Huo Xingming walked out of the restroom with a gloomy expression and asked a staff member, “Did Bai Siyi leave work again?”
The staff member looked at him, feeling a little sorry for the guy. He had chased after love all the way into a factory, only to find himself working on an assembly line while the person he liked only worked half-days and was nowhere to be seen.
The staff member nodded. “Xiao Bai went to eat a little after eleven. He’s probably done by now.”
When Huo Xingming first started working, Bai Siyi had worried that he wouldn’t be able to handle the job, that he might get bullied in the factory, or that he wouldn’t dare to eat in the cafeteria—or worse, wouldn’t get enough to eat.
So, for the first two days, Bai Siyi made a point of coming to find him at mealtime.
But after only two days, Bai Siyi stopped showing up.
Huo Xingming was heartbroken. “He’s actually avoiding me like this? He’s so cruel!”
The staff member: “……”
As much as they felt bad for Huo Xingming, they also felt bad for Bai Siyi.
Bai Siyi must have been under a lot of psychological pressure.
After all, he was deep in debt and pretending to be a woman. Facing Huo Xingming’s pursuit must have been incredibly difficult for him.
In the end, Huo Xingming ate alone in the cafeteria.
Because he couldn’t see Bai Siyi and still had to do hard labor at the factory, he was so heartbroken that he barely ate.
Normally, he could eat five plates—now, he could only eat three!
Bai Siyi was, in fact, deliberately avoiding Huo Xingming.
He knew Huo Xingming had a heavy workload, so every morning, he would eat breakfast in the Pink House, then time his arrival at the workshop just right to avoid running into Huo Xingming in the cafeteria.
Then, he would rush to finish his work before eleven, quickly eat lunch, and leave the factory as soon as possible.
“I don’t want to see him anymore.”
Bai Siyi told the staff and the live stream audience, “The more I think about it, the worse I feel. Huo Xingming is actually pretty pitiful. He’s a straight guy who got scammed by my fake contact info, and worst of all, he still doesn’t know I’m a man. I feel like the worst person in the world.”
The staff member: “……”

The staff also tried to comfort Bai Siyi. “Xiao Bai, don’t blame yourself too much. Mr. Huo might not even hold it against you. It’s just a show, he should be able to understand.”
But Bai Siyi wasn’t feeling optimistic.
If this were just a regular partnership for a variety show, maybe Huo Xingming could understand. But right now, it was clear that Huo Xingming actually liked him. How was he supposed to explain that?
Bai Siyi tried putting himself in the same situation. If he liked a top and then found out that person was actually a straight man pretending to be gay—someone who only liked women—he would absolutely lose his mind on the spot.
A staff member asked him, “So, have you finished writing your confession letter for tomorrow, Xiao Bai?”
Hearing this, Bai Siyi fell silent and shook his head. “Not yet.”
He had been avoiding Huo Xingming for days, ignoring his calls and messages, trying to force himself to calm down.
A man carrying a million-yuan debt had no right to fall in love.
But he hadn’t expected the confession segment—something he thought was far off—to arrive so soon. In fact, it was happening tomorrow.
After tomorrow, he might never see Huo Xingming again.
Suddenly, he regretted not having lunch with him today.
Because after this, he might never get another chance.
Inside the Pink House, the other three female contestants were sitting on the couch, each holding a pen and a pink piece of stationery, their expressions mixed.
Bai Siyi had been feeling down these past few days and hadn’t chatted much with them. Now that he was about to leave the show, he felt a bit lost—maybe even reluctant to part with everyone.
Celebrity contestant Qiu Bo had been tugging at her hair for half an hour. When she turned and saw Bai Siyi staring blankly at his untouched paper, she lowered her voice and asked, “Xiao Bai, what are you spacing out for? Aren’t you going to write?”
Bai Siyi pursed his lips. “I don’t know what to write.”
Qiu Bo sighed. “Yeah, seriously, how the hell are we supposed to write this stupid thing?”
Bai Siyi looked at Qiu Bo’s messy hair. A celebrity, sitting there on a live stream, yanking at her hair until it was a total disaster.
He lowered his voice and asked, “How are things going with your online crush?”
Qiu Bo: “…”
Her face suspiciously turned red. She looked away, avoiding eye contact. “It’s… just okay.”
Bai Siyi raised an eyebrow. “Just okay? What does that mean?”
Qiu Bo covered her face awkwardly. She had been holding back so much over the past few days, but among the female contestants, the domineering CEO type was too cold, and the university student was way too naive—Qiu Bo just couldn’t relate to either of them.
Now that Bai Siyi finally had some free time, she couldn’t hold it in any longer!
She hesitated for a moment, still covering her face in embarrassment, then leaned in closer and whispered mysteriously, “You won’t believe it… my partner—uh, I mean, the person I was matched with… she’s a woman!”
Bai Siyi: “…”
His mouth fell open slightly, stunned.
Qiu Bo’s voice dropped even lower. “Shocking, right? I didn’t expect it either! Damn, she was actually cross-dressing as a guy. She’s so shameless!”
Bai Siyi had never been sure about the other female contestants’ sexual orientations. He had assumed this show, like the first season, was strictly a traditional male-female dating show.
That was why his presence, dressed as a woman, felt so out of place.
But now, how was there a girl among the male contestants?
His brain struggled to process the information. He couldn’t even figure out how Qiu Bo had discovered it.
So his first question was: “How did you find out?”
Qiu Bo rolled her eyes. “Come on, I’m not an idiot! No matter how convincing she is, she still can’t grow a…”
She paused, cleared her throat, and changed the subject. “Anyway, not a guy is not a guy.”
Bai Siyi: “…”
He glanced down at his own chest, then touched his face. So… why hadn’t Huo Xingming noticed yet?
What an idiot.
Wait.
After a long pause, Bai Siyi finally reacted. “Wait a minute. Aren’t the male contestants supposed to be men? How is there a woman among them?”
At this moment, Xi Mo, who was sitting across from them, suddenly chuckled. She lazily glanced at Bai Siyi and, in front of the live stream camera, said, “Xiao Bai, why are you so slow? This dating show has all kinds of orientations. Qiu Bo is a lesbian—didn’t you know?”
Bai Siyi: “…”
He was stunned all over again.
He really didn’t know!
Seeing Bai Siyi’s expression, Xi Mo immediately understood—he had been completely clueless.
No wonder—at the beginning of the show, Xi Mo had tried to flirt with Bai Siyi. But Bai Siyi didn’t respond, so she had assumed he was rejecting her.
Qiu Bo explained, “I’m gay, you’re gay, so we’re best sisters.”
Bai Siyi: “…”
Suddenly, Qiu Bo hissed, “Damn, we really are alike… Wait a sec, do you think that farmer guy of yours… could be gay too?”
Bai Siyi: “…”
Bai Siyi was completely stunned. ×3
Could Huo Xingming be gay? A spark of hope surged in Bai Siyi’s heart.
But he quickly shook his head. “He’s not.”
His face turned red as he explained, “I think he likes me.”
He liked Bai Siyi as a woman.
As soon as he said that, Bai Siyi started feeling down again.
Qiu Bo patted him on the shoulder. “It’s fine, it’s just a thank-you letter. Just search it up on Baidu. Want me to write it so you can copy?”
Bai Siyi shook his head, looking a little dejected. “No need, I’ll do it myself.”
There were a lot of things he wanted to say to Huo Xingming. His letter might end up completely filling the page.
Although… his handwriting wasn’t exactly neat. He wasn’t sure if Huo Xingming, who had grown up overseas, would even be able to read it.
Tomorrow afternoon was the confession segment. By then, Huo Xingming would probably hate him.
His first time liking someone—he never expected it to end like this.
Bai Siyi picked up his pen. He had only written the opening line when his nose stung, and his eyes welled up with tears.
Just then, a loud voice suddenly called from outside the Pink House—
“Bai Siyi!”
Huo Xingming’s voice was booming, loud enough for everyone inside the Pink House to hear crystal clear.

Everyone looked up at Bai Siyi.
Bai Siyi: “…”
He had already taken a shower and even had an afternoon nap. Now, with his hair tied up in a bun, no makeup, wearing a loose-fitting men’s T-shirt and shorts, he sat dumbfounded on the sofa—completely frozen like a stone statue.
Outside the door, Huo Xingming was still shouting, “Bai Siyi! I know you’re in there! Stop hiding and come out! Come out! I have something to tell you!”
Huo Xingming wanted to tell him—he could pay off his debt, he could find a good job, and he wouldn’t become a burden to Bai Siyi. In fact, he could even help Bai Siyi.
He wanted to tell him—he just liked Bai Siyi! No one else would do! If Bai Siyi didn’t like something about him, he could change it.
Except for the fact that he was mixed-race—he really couldn’t do anything about that.
But if it came down to it, he could dye his hair black, wear colored contacts, tan his skin, and work hard to become a proper-looking East Asian!
If Bai Siyi still rejected him after all this—then don’t blame him for going full-on cry, fuss, and threaten to jump!
Huo Xingming: “Bai Siyi! Come out already! If you don’t, I’m not leaving tonight!”
Bai Siyi: “…”
